SureWick® Pad Materials are designed and optimised for use in rapid diagnostic lateral flow tests that require superior consistency and performance. SureWick® cellulose fiber pad materials are used as sample and absorbant pads in lateral flow assays. This pack contains 100 strips of 20mm x 300mm C083 cellulose fiber pad material.
應用
SureWick® Pad Materials are optimised for use as sample, conjugate, or absorbent pads in a broad range of Lateral Flow test applications, including Infectious Disease testing (COVID-19, HIV, Influenza, Malaria, STDs etc.), as well as in women’s health, biomarker detection, drugs of abuse testing, drug development, environmental testing, agricultural applications, food safety, product quality testing, and animal health.
特點和優勢
- SureWick® cellulose fiber pads are made from non-woven, 100% pure cellulose fiber.
- These pads do not contain binders or glues, which can interfere with assay performance.
- Manufactured to ensure excellent consistency, they provide reliable, predictable sample flow.
- They exhibit consistent thickness, bed volume, and uniform surface quality.
